--- Comment #3 from Elizabeth <elizabethx.de.la.torre.mena at intel.com> ---
>From dmesg:
traps: gnome-shell[4551] trap int3 ip:7f551f015261 sp:7ffe0d54e610 error:0
nfsd: last server has exited, flushing export cache
So basically the problem you're reporting is the X crash after plugin and
unplug?? Is this desktop dependent??
It seems that you have an issue with dmc, could you try please try to reinstall
dmc?
i915 0000:00:02.0: Direct firmware load for i915/kbl_dmc_ver1_01.bin failed
with error -2
i915 0000:00:02.0: Failed to load DMC firmware i915/kbl_dmc_ver1_01.bin.
Disabling runtime power management.
i915 0000:00:02.0: DMC firmware homepage:
https://01.org/linuxgraphics/downloads/firmware
[drm:intel_fbc_init] Sanitized enable_fbc value: 1
Have you tried i915.enable_rc6=0 or i915.enable_fbc=0 on grub?
[drm:intel_cpu_fifo_underrun_irq_handler] *ERROR* CPU pipe B FIFO underrun
[drm:intel_fbc_underrun_work_fn] Disabling FBC due to FIFO underrun.
Not sure if this are relevant:
[drm:drm_dp_dpcd_access] Too many retries, giving up. First error: -5
[drm:drm_dp_dpcd_access] Too many retries, giving up. First error: -5
[drm:drm_dp_dpcd_access] Too many retries, giving up. First error: -5
[drm:drm_dp_dpcd_access] Too many retries, giving up. First error: -5
[drm:process_single_tx_qlock] failed to dpcd write 10 -5
[drm:process_single_tx_qlock] sideband msg failed to send
[drm:process_single_down_tx_qlock] failed to send msg in q -5
